Output 21f59faed8acdcb97e3260945bb8f33f0ac373b7b75323f5f3b87cbfa3efd44c:1

value
2647915
script pubkey
OP_0 OP_PUSHBYTES_20 983a7aa40f28754e98c0371d94954f50ecb885c1
address
bc1qnqa84fq09p65axxqxuwef9202rkt3pwpf4eteu
transaction
21f59faed8acdcb97e3260945bb8f33f0ac373b7b75323f5f3b87cbfa3efd44c
spent
true